因特网对语言的影响的英语作文The Impact of the Internet on Language.The advent of the Internet has revolutionized the way we communicate, learn, and express ourselves. One of the most significant impacts of the Internet has been its influence on language. The digital realm has introduced new terminologies, altered the way we use existing words, and even given rise to new languages and dialects. In this essay, we delve into the profound influence of the Internet on language and its implications for global communication.The Emergence of New Terminologies.The Internet has given birth to a vast array of new terminologies that reflect the unique characteristics of digital communication. Terms like "blog," "chatbot," "hashtag," "cyberspace," and "wiki" are directly associated with the development of the World Wide Web and the technologies it has spawned. These terms have not onlyfound their way into our daily vocabulary but have also become integral to understanding the modern digital landscape.Alteration of Existing Words.The Internet has not only introduced new words but has also transformed the meaning and usage of existing ones. For instance, the word "google" has evolved from being a proper noun referring to the search engine giant to a verb meaning "to search for information on the Internet." Similarly, terms like "friend" and "like" have acquired new meanings and contexts on social media platforms.The Rise of Emojis and Visual Language.The Internet has also given rise to a new form ofvisual language, primarily represented by emojis. Emojis are graphical representations of facial expressions, objects, and ideas that allow users to express their feelings and thoughts visually. Their popularity has exploded in recent years, especially among youngergenerations, who often prefer to communicate using emojis rather than words.The Globalization of Language.The Internet has accelerated the globalization of language. People from different cultures and backgrounds can now communicate with each other seamlessly, thanks to the common language of the Internet – English. English has become the lingua franca of the digital world, enabling global communication and collaboration. However, this has also led to the marginalization of languages spoken by smaller communities.The Birth of New Languages and Dialects.Interestingly, the Internet has also given rise to new languages and dialects. These include "netspeak," a colloquial language used primarily in online forums and chat rooms, and "lingo," a blend of English and technology-related terms used by the tech-savvy generation. Furthermore, the rise of social media platforms has led tothe emergence of regional dialects and accents that reflect the unique cultural and linguistic identities of specific communities.Conclusion.The Internet has had a profound impact on language, transforming the way we communicate and express ourselves. It has introduced new terminologies, altered the meaning and usage of existing words, given rise to new forms of visual language, and accelerated the globalization of English. However, this influence also raises concerns about the marginalization of lesser-known languages and the homogenization of global culture. It is important to recognize the role of the Internet in shaping language and its impact on our cultural and social identities.。
英语中国传统美术绘画作文**English Essay on Traditional Chinese Fine ArtPainting**China, a country with a rich cultural heritage, is renowned for its traditional fine art painting, which has evolved throughout the centuries, reflecting the spirit and essence of the nation. This art form, with its intricate brushstrokes and profound symbolism, is not just a means of visual expression but also a window into the ancient wisdom and philosophy of China.Traditional Chinese painting, often known as Guohua, is characterized by its unique aesthetics and techniques. The brushwork, often executed with meticulous care, ranges from delicate lines to bold strokes, each carrying a unique emotional and symbolic value. The use of ink and watercolor, combined with the artist's skill, creates a dynamic and harmonious composition, often leaving the viewer with a sense of tranquility and beauty.One of the defining features of Chinese painting is its emphasis on the representation of nature and landscape.Mountains, rivers, trees, and clouds are frequent subjects, often depicted in a way that transcends their physical form, becoming symbols of broader themes such as eternity, change, and the harmony of the universe. These paintings are not mere representations of the natural world; they are meditations on the interconnectedness of all things and the role of humanity within it.Another notable aspect of Chinese painting is its focus on calligraphy, the art of writing. Calligraphy is often integrated into paintings, not only as inscriptions butalso as an integral part of the composition. The beauty of the written characters, with their flowing lines and rhythmic patterns, adds depth and dynamism to the paintings, making them even more captivating.In addition to landscape and calligraphy, Chinese painting also includes genres such as figure painting,bird-and-flower painting, and decorative patterns. Each genre has its unique techniques and symbolism, reflectingthe diverse cultural traditions and historical contexts of China.The influence of traditional Chinese painting is far-reaching, extending beyond the boundaries of China and influencing artists and art movements worldwide. Its emphasis on the expression of inner feelings and the harmonious coexistence with nature resonates with people from different cultures, making it a universal language of art.In conclusion, traditional Chinese fine art painting is a rich and diverse art form that encapsulates the essenceof Chinese culture and philosophy. Its intricate brushwork, profound symbolism, and focus on nature and calligraphy make it a unique and captivating form of visual expression. squirrel英语文章篇一:Squirrels are fascinating creatures that can be found in various parts of the world. These small, agile mammals are known for their bushy tails and their ability to climb trees effortlessly. They belong to the family Sciuridae, which includes over 200 species.One of the most common species of squirrels is the Eastern gray squirrel, found in North America. These squirrels are known for their gray fur and white underbellies. They are highly adaptable and can be found in a variety of habitats, including forests, parks, and even urban areas. Eastern gray squirrels are known for their acrobatic abilities, as they can leap from tree to tree and navigate through branches with ease.Another well-known species is the red squirrel, found in Europe, Asia, and North America. These squirrels are characterized by theirreddish-brown fur and tufted ears. Red squirrels are known for their agility, as they can run quickly along branches and jump from tree to tree. They are also known for their ability to hoard food, storing nuts and seeds in various locations to ensure their survival during the winter months.Squirrels are omnivorous creatures, meaning they eat a variety of foods.Their diet primarily consists of nuts, seeds, fruits, and fungi. However, they are opportunistic feeders and will also eat insects, eggs, and small vertebrates if the opportunity arises. Their sharp incisor teeth enable them to gnaw through hard shells to access the nutritious contents inside.Squirrels play an important role in forest ecosystems as seed dispersers. When they bury nuts and seeds for later consumption, they often forget or fail to retrieve them, allowing for the germination and growth of new plants. This behavior makes squirrels vital for maintaining the biodiversity of forests.In addition to their ecological role, squirrels also serve as a source of entertainment for many people. Their playful behavior, such as chasing each other or jumping from tree to tree, can be a joy to watch. Squirrels have also been popularized in pop culture, with characters like Scrat from the Ice Age movies becoming iconic representations of these small creatures.However, squirrels can also present challenges, particularly when they enter urban areas. They may raid bird feeders or damage gardens by digging holes to bury their food. Some people also consider them pests due to their ability to chew through electrical wires, causing potential hazards.Overall, squirrels are fascinating creatures that are both beneficial and sometimes problematic. Their ability to adapt to different environments, their acrobatic skills, and their role in seed dispersal make them a unique and important part of the natural world.。
